Comparative evaluation of large language models and clinicians in real-world glaucoma clinical reasoning
Purpose Clinical decision-making in glaucoma is complex and requires integration of heterogeneous information, including patient history, examination findings, and risk stratification. While artificial intelligence (AI) has shown strong performance in image-based ophthalmic tasks, its capability in specialty-specific clinical reasoning remains insufficiently explored. Methods Performance was evaluated by glaucoma specialists using a predefined rubric across three clinically oriented domains: medical accuracy (40…
In a 34-case glaucoma reasoning test, LLM systems produced structured reasoning with weighted scores overlapping attending ophthalmologists and often included safety-critical diagnostic and management elements.
LLM reasoning did not establish clinical equivalence in this limited evaluation and requires specialist oversight and further validation before clinical use.
Findings are based on a limited 34-case dataset and described as exploratory, not establishing clinical equivalence, with substantial variability among human clinicians.
